Sputnik V was a better choice of vaccine as a second jab than Sinopharm for those who had taken AstraZeneca injection as the first dose, experts in Immunology at the Medical Research Institute (MRI) told The Island yesterday.

Consultant Immunologist and head of the department of Immunology-MRI, Dr Nihan Rajiva de Silva said if those who had taken the first dose of AstraZeneca were to receive a second jab of Sputnik V, they should take the first Sputnik V vaccine with adenovirus 26 (Ad26).

“This is my personal opinion as an Immunologist. There are several on-going research on mixing and matching vaccines in the world.

“There is a study in Russia on the mixing of Sputnik V with AstraZeneca and the results should be out soon. There is also studies on mixing AstraZeneca and Pfizer.  Given that our choices now are between Sputnik-V and Sinopharm, I think it’s better to go for Sputnik-V, if you had taken a first dose of AstraZeneca,” Dr. de Silva said.

Meanwhile former acting Chairman of NMRA, Prof. Sisira Siribaddana too suggested that Sputnik-V is a better option for those who had taken the first AstraZeneca shot.

“Sinopharm is a good vaccine too. It has fewer side effects than others. But in this case, Sputnik-V is better,” he said.
